form3.vb

来自「学生成绩管理系统」· VB 代码 · 共 45 行

VB
45
字号
Public Class Form3

   

    Private Sub Form3_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        ComboBox1.Items.Add("学号")
        ComboBox1.Items.Add("课号")
    End Sub

   



    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
        Module1.db()
        conn.Open()
        ds.Clear()

        If ComboBox1.Text = "学号" Then
            cmd.CommandText = "select stu.sname,sc.cno,course.cname,sc.grade from stu,sc,course where stu.sno=sc.sno and sc.cno=course.cno and stu.sno='" & TextBox1.Text & "'"

            da.SelectCommand = cmd
            da.Fill(ds, "tab31")

            DataGridView1.DataSource = ds.Tables("tab31")
        ElseIf ComboBox1.Text = "课号" Then
            cmd.CommandText = "select stu.sno,stu.sname,course.cname,sc.grade from stu,sc,course where stu.sno=sc.sno and sc.cno=course.cno and course.cno='" & TextBox1.Text & "'"

            da.SelectCommand = cmd
            da.Fill(ds, "tab32")
            DataGridView1.DataSource = ds.Tables("tab32")
        End If

        conn.Close()
    End Sub

    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click
        Me.Close()

    End Sub

    Private Sub DataGridView1_CellContentClick(ByVal sender As System.Object, ByVal e As System.Windows.Forms.DataGridViewCellEventArgs) Handles DataGridView1.CellContentClick

    End Sub
End Class

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?